Every seed that is selected has to be disease-free, pest-free, insect-free and infection-free. Healthy parents will have healthy offspring. Thus, the really first step of better jatropha curcas crop is to have finest quality seeds, with a hereditary make-up similar to that of the moms and dad plants. This is the basic guideline governing the growth of ex-vitro Jatropha. Then the seeds are grown in the neighboring plantations or green homes, where they are appropriately seasoned to the natural conditions the plant is really going to grow in, and enabled to grow into small plantlets. The plantlets ought to be two months old when they are considered old enough to be re-planted. At this stage, the provision of correct well drained soil is vital ... something that is taken care of externally by the experimenters as this is vital for a correct growth. And the soil nutrients are well-balanced so that the plant gets all that it needs to grow and propagate. The ex-vitro jatropha curcas gets appropriate nurturing and nourishment and care at every phase of growth and therefore, a succulent crop can be gathered at correct time.
